US Senate confirms Kristi Noem as Homeland Security Secretary

The United States Senate has voted to confirm South Dakota Governor Kristi Noem as secretary of the Department of Homeland Security.

Fox News reports that the development makes her the fourth of President Donald Trump’s nominees to win approval from the Senate.

The vote was 59–34 with all Republicans present voting yes and seven Democrats voting yes.

Noem had been expected to be confirmed comfortably, having faced no significant issues during her confirmation hearing.

Noem becomes the fourth of Trump’s picks to be confirmed, behind Secretary of State Marco Rubio, CIA Director John Ratcliffe and Secretary of Defense Pete Hegseth.
